What is sipwitch-plugin-forward
This plugin enables forwarding of registration requests and destination routes for unknown numbers so that one can create a “secure” peer to peer media domain managed by sipwitch and still access an “insecure” b2bua based ip-pbx.

Install sipwitch-plugin-forward on Fedora 36 Using dnf
Update yum database with dnf
using the following command.
sudo dnf makecache --refresh
After updating yum database, We can install sipwitch-plugin-forward
using dnf
by running the following command:
sudo dnf -y install sipwitch-plugin-forward
